     19 static void
     20 help_virtual_device( stralloc_t*  out )
     21 {
     22     PRINTF(
     23     "  An Android Virtual Device (AVD) models a single virtual\n"
     24     "  device running the Android platform that has, at least, its own\n"
     25     "  kernel, system image and data partition.\n\n"
     26 
     27     "  Only one emulator process can run a given AVD at a time, but\n"
     28     "  you can create several AVDs and run them concurrently.\n\n"
     29 
     30     "  You can invoke a given AVD at startup using either '-avd <name>'\n"
     31     "  or '@<name>', both forms being equivalent. For example, to launch\n"
     32     "  the AVD named 'foo', type:\n\n"
     33 
     34     "      emulator @foo\n\n"
     35 
     36     "  The 'android' helper tool can be used to manage virtual devices.\n"
     37     "  For example:\n\n"
     38 
     39     "    android create avd -n <name> -t 1  # creates a new virtual device.\n"
     40     "    android list avd                   # list all virtual devices available.\n\n"
     41 
     42     "  Try 'android --help' for more commands.\n\n"
     43 
     44     "  Each AVD really corresponds to a content directory which stores\n"
     45     "  persistent and writable disk images as well as configuration files.\n"
     46 
     47     "  Each AVD must be created against an existing SDK platform or add-on.\n"
     48     "  For more information on this topic, see -help-sdk-images.\n\n"
     49 
     50     "  SPECIAL NOTE: in the case where you are *not* using the emulator\n"
     51     "  with the Android SDK, but with the Android build system, you will\n"
     52     "  need to define the ANDROID_PRODUCT_OUT variable in your environment.\n"
     53     "  See -help-build-images for the details.\n"
     54     );
     55 }
     56 
     57 
     58 static void
     59 help_sdk_images( stralloc_t*  out )
     60 {
     61     PRINTF(
     62     "  The Android SDK now supports multiple versions of the Android platform.\n"
     63     "  Each SDK 'platform' corresponds to:\n\n"
     64 
     65     "    - a given version of the Android API.\n"
     66     "    - a set of corresponding system image files.\n"
     67     "    - build and configuration properties.\n"
     68     "    - an android.jar file used when building your application.\n"
     69     "    - skins.\n\n"
     70 
     71     "  The Android SDK also supports the concept of 'add-ons'. Each add-on is\n"
     72     "  based on an existing platform, and provides replacement or additional\n"
     73     "  image files, android.jar, hardware configuration options and/or skins.\n\n"
     74 
     75     "  The purpose of add-ons is to allow vendors to provide their own customized\n"
     76     "  system images and APIs without needing to package a complete SDK.\n\n"
     77 
     78     "  Before using the SDK, you need to create an Android Virtual Device (AVD)\n"
     79     "  (see -help-virtual-device for details). Each AVD is created in reference\n"
     80     "  to a given SDK platform *or* add-on, and will search the corresponding\n"
     81     "  directories for system image files, in the following order:\n\n"
     82 
     83     "    - in the AVD's content directory.\n"
     84     "    - in the AVD's SDK add-on directory, if any.\n"
     85     "    - in the AVD's SDK platform directory, if any.\n\n"
     86 
     87     "  The image files are documented in -help-disk-images. By default, an AVD\n"
     88     "  content directory will contain the following persistent image files:\n\n"
     89 
     90     "     userdata-qemu.img     - the /data partition image file\n"
     91     "     cache.img             - the /cache partition image file\n\n"
     92 
     93     "  You can use -wipe-data to re-initialize the /data partition to its factory\n"
     94     "  defaults. This will erase all user settings for the virtual device.\n\n"
     95     );
     96 }
     97 
     98 static void
     99 help_build_images( stralloc_t*  out )
    100 {
    101     PRINTF(
    102     "  The emulator detects that you are working from the Android build system\n"
    103     "  by looking at the ANDROID_PRODUCT_OUT variable in your environment.\n\n"
    104 
    105     "  If it is defined, it should point to the product-specific directory that\n"
    106     "  contains the generated system images.\n"
    107 
    108     "  In this case, the emulator will look by default for the following image\n"
    109     "  files there:\n\n"
    110 
    111     "    - system.img   : the *initial* system image.\n"
    112     "    - ramdisk.img  : the ramdisk image used to boot the system.\n"
    113     "    - userdata.img : the *initial* user data image (see below).\n"
    114     "    - kernel-qemu  : the emulator-specific Linux kernel image.\n\n"
    115 
    116     "  If the kernel image is not found in the out directory, then it is searched\n"
    117     "  in <build-root>/prebuilts/qemu-kernel/.\n\n"
    118 
    119     "  Skins will be looked in <build-root>/development/tools/emulator/skins/\n\n"
    120 
    121     "  You can use the -sysdir, -system, -kernel, -ramdisk, -datadir, -data options\n"
    122     "  to specify different search directories or specific image files. You can\n"
    123     "  also use the -cache and -sdcard options to indicate specific cache partition\n"
    124     "  and SD Card image files.\n\n"
    125 
    126     "  For more details, see the corresponding -help-<option> section.\n\n"
    127 
    128     "  Note that the following behaviour is specific to 'build mode':\n\n"
    129 
    130     "  - the *initial* system image is copied to a temporary file which is\n"
    131     "    automatically removed when the emulator exits. There is thus no way to\n"
    132     "    make persistent changes to this image through the emulator, even if\n"
    133     "    you use the '-image <file>' option.\n\n"
    134 
    135     "  - unless you use the '-cache <file>' option, the cache partition image\n"
    136     "    is backed by a temporary file that is initially empty and destroyed on\n"
    137     "    program exit.\n\n"
    138 
    139     "  SPECIAL NOTE: If you are using the emulator with the Android SDK, the\n"
    140     "  information above doesn't apply. See -help-sdk-images for more details.\n"
    141     );
    142 }

    144 static void
    145 help_disk_images( stralloc_t*  out )
    146 {
    147     char  datadir[256];
    148 
    149     bufprint_config_path( datadir, datadir + sizeof(datadir) );
    150 
    151     PRINTF(
    152     "  The emulator needs several key image files to run appropriately.\n"
    153     "  Their exact location depends on whether you're using the emulator\n"
    154     "  from the Android SDK, or not (more details below).\n\n"
    155 
    156     "  The minimal required image files are the following:\n\n"
    157 
    158     "    kernel-qemu      the emulator-specific Linux kernel image\n"
    159     "    ramdisk.img      the ramdisk image used to boot the system\n"
    160     "    system.img       the *initial* system image\n"
    161     "    userdata.img     the *initial* data partition image\n\n"
    162 
    163     "  It will also use the following writable image files:\n\n"
    164 
    165     "    userdata-qemu.img  the persistent data partition image\n"
    166     "    system-qemu.img    an *optional* persistent system image\n"
    167     "    cache.img          an *optional* cache partition image\n"
    168     "    sdcard.img         an *optional* SD Card partition image\n\n"
    169     "    snapshots.img      an *optional* state snapshots image\n\n"
    170 
    171     "  If you use a virtual device, its content directory should store\n"
    172     "  all writable images, and read-only ones will be found from the\n"
    173     "  corresponding platform/add-on directories. See -help-sdk-images\n"
    174     "  for more details.\n\n"
    175 
    176     "  If you are building from the Android build system, you should\n"
    177     "  have ANDROID_PRODUCT_OUT defined in your environment, and the\n"
    178     "  emulator shall be able to pick-up the right image files automatically.\n"
    179     "  See -help-build-images for more details.\n\n"
    180 
    181     "  If you're neither using the SDK or the Android build system, you\n"
    182     "  can still run the emulator by explicitely providing the paths to\n"
    183     "  *all* required disk images through a combination of the following\n"
    184     "  options: -sysdir, -datadir, -kernel, -ramdisk, -system, -data, -cache\n"
    185     "  -sdcard and -snapstorage.\n\n"
    186 
    187     "  The actual logic being that the emulator should be able to find all\n"
    188     "  images from the options you give it.\n\n"
    189 
    190     "  For more detail, see the corresponding -help-<option> entry.\n\n"
    191 
    192     "  Other related options are:\n\n"
    193 
    194     "      -init-data       Specify an alternative *initial* user data image\n\n"
    195 
    196     "      -wipe-data       Copy the content of the *initial* user data image\n"
    197 "                           (userdata.img) into the writable one (userdata-qemu.img)\n\n"
    198 
    199     "      -no-cache        do not use a cache partition, even if one is\n"
    200     "                       available.\n\n"
    201 
    202     "      -no-snapstorage  do not use a state snapshot image, even if one is\n"
    203     "                       available.\n\n"
    204     ,
    205     datadir );
    206 }

    387 static void
    388 help_char_devices(stralloc_t*  out)
    389 {
    390     PRINTF(
    391     "  various emulation options take a <device> specification that can be used to\n"
    392     "  specify something to hook to an emulated device or communication channel.\n"
    393     "  here is the list of supported <device> specifications:\n\n"
    394 
    395     "      stdio\n"
    396     "          standard input/output. this may be subject to character\n"
    397     "          translation (e.g. LN <=> CR/LF)\n\n"
    398 
    399     "      COM<n>   [Windows only]\n"
    400     "          where <n> is a digit. host serial communication port.\n\n"
    401 
    402     "      pipe:<filename>\n"
    403     "          named pipe <filename>\n\n"
    404 
    405     "      file:<filename>\n"
    406     "          write output to <filename>, no input can be read\n\n"
    407 
    408     "      pty  [Linux only]\n"
    409     "          pseudo TTY (a new PTY is automatically allocated)\n\n"
    410 
    411     "      /dev/<file>  [Unix only]\n"
    412     "          host char device file, e.g. /dev/ttyS0. may require root access\n\n"
    413 
    414     "      /dev/parport<N>  [Linux only]\n"
    415     "          use host parallel port. may require root access\n\n"
    416 
    417     "      unix:<path>[,server][,nowait]]     [Unix only]\n"
    418     "          use a Unix domain socket. if you use the 'server' option, then\n"
    419     "          the emulator will create the socket and wait for a client to\n"
    420     "          connect before continuing, unless you also use 'nowait'\n\n"
    421 
    422     "      tcp:[<host>]:<port>[,server][,nowait][,nodelay]\n"
    423     "          use a TCP socket. 'host' is set to localhost by default. if you\n"
    424     "          use the 'server' option will bind the port and wait for a client\n"
    425     "          to connect before continuing, unless you also use 'nowait'. the\n"
    426     "          'nodelay' option disables the TCP Nagle algorithm\n\n"
    427 
    428     "      telnet:[<host>]:<port>[,server][,nowait][,nodelay]\n"
    429     "          similar to 'tcp:' but uses the telnet protocol instead of raw TCP\n\n"
    430 
    431     "      udp:[<remote_host>]:<remote_port>[@[<src_ip>]:<src_port>]\n"
    432     "          send output to a remote UDP server. if 'remote_host' is no\n"
    433     "          specified it will default to '0.0.0.0'. you can also receive input\n"
    434     "          through UDP by specifying a source address after the optional '@'.\n\n"
    435 
    436     "      fdpair:<fd1>,<fd2>  [Unix only]\n"
    437     "          redirection input and output to a pair of pre-opened file\n"
    438     "          descriptors. this is mostly useful for scripts and other\n"
    439     "          programmatic launches of the emulator.\n\n"
    440 
    441     "      none\n"
    442     "          no device connected\n\n"
    443 
    444     "      null\n"
    445     "          the null device (a.k.a /dev/null on Unix, or NUL on Win32)\n\n"
    446 
    447     "  NOTE: these correspond to the <device> parameter of the QEMU -serial option\n"
    448     "        as described on http://bellard.org/qemu/qemu-doc.html#SEC10\n\n"
    449     );
    450 }

    653 static void
    654 help_snapshot(stralloc_t*  out)
    655 {
    656     PRINTF(
    657     "  Rather than executing a full boot sequence, the Android emulator can\n"
    658     "  resume execution from an earlier state snapshot (which is usually\n"
    659     "  significantly faster). When the parameter '-snapshot <name>' is given,\n"
    660     "  the emulator loads the snapshot of that name from the snapshot image,\n"
    661     "  and saves it back under the same name on exit.\n\n"
    662 
    663     "  If the option is not specified, it defaults to 'default-boot'. If the\n"
    664     "  specified snapshot does not exist, the emulator will perform a full boot\n"
    665     "  sequence instead, but will still save.\n\n"
    666 
    667     "  WARNING: In the process of loading, all contents of the system, userdata\n"
    668     "           and SD card images will be OVERWRITTEN with the contents they\n"
    669     "           held when the snapshot was made. Unless saved in a different\n"
    670     "           snapshot, any changes since will be lost!\n\n"
    671 
    672     "  If you want to create a snapshot manually, connect to the emulator console:\n\n"
    673 
    674     "      telnet localhost <port>\n\n"
    675 
    676     "  Then execute the command 'avd snapshot save <name>'. See '-help-port' for\n"
    677     "  information on obtaining <port>.\n\n"
    678     );
    679 }

    823 static void
    824 help_report_console(stralloc_t*  out)
    825 {
    826     PRINTF(
    827     "  the '-report-console <socket>' option can be used to report the\n"
    828     "  automatically-assigned console port number to a remote third-party\n"
    829     "  before starting the emulation. <socket> must be in one of these\n"
    830     "  formats:\n\n"
    831 
    832     "      tcp:<port>[,server][,max=<seconds>]\n"
    833     "      unix:<path>[,server][,max=<seconds>]\n"
    834     "\n"
    835     "  if the 'server' option is used, the emulator opens a server socket\n"
    836     "  and waits for an incoming connection to it. by default, it will instead\n"
    837     "  try to make a normal client connection to the socket, and, in case of\n"
    838     "  failure, will repeat this operation every second for 10 seconds.\n"
    839     "  the 'max=<seconds>' option can be used to modify the timeout\n\n"
    840 
    841     "  when the connection is established, the emulator sends its console port\n"
    842     "  number as text to the remote third-party, then closes the connection and\n"
    843     "  starts the emulation as usual. *any* failure in the process described here\n"
    844     "  will result in the emulator aborting immediately\n\n"
    845 
    846     "  as an example, here's a small Unix shell script that starts the emulator in\n"
    847     "  the background and waits for its port number with the help of the 'netcat'\n"
    848     "  utility:\n\n"
    849 
    850     "      MYPORT=5000\n"
    851     "      emulator -no-window -report-console tcp:$MYPORT &\n"
    852     "      CONSOLEPORT=`nc -l localhost $MYPORT`\n"
    853     "\n"
    854     );
    855 }

    883 static void
    884 help_scale(stralloc_t*  out)
    885 {
    886     PRINTF(
    887     "  the '-scale <scale>' option is used to scale the emulator window to\n"
    888     "  something that better fits the physical dimensions of a real device. this\n"
    889     "  can be *very* useful to check that your UI isn't too small to be usable\n"
    890     "  on a real device.\n\n"
    891 
    892     "  there are three supported formats for <scale>:\n\n"
    893 
    894     "  * if <scale> is a real number (between 0.1 and 3.0) it is used as a\n"
    895     "    scaling factor for the emulator's window.\n\n"
    896 
    897     "  * if <scale> is an integer followed by the suffix 'dpi' (e.g. '110dpi'),\n"
    898     "    then it is interpreted as the resolution of your monitor screen. this\n"
    899     "    will be divided by the emulated device's resolution to get an absolute\n"
    900     "    scale. (see -help-dpi-device for details).\n\n"
    901 
    902     "  * finally, if <scale> is the keyword 'auto', the emulator tries to guess\n"
    903     "    your monitor's resolution and automatically adjusts its window\n"
    904     "    accordingly\n\n"
    905 
    906     "    NOTE: this process is *very* unreliable, depending on your OS, video\n"
    907     "          driver issues and other random system parameters\n\n"
    908 
    909     "  the emulator's scale can be changed anytime at runtime through the control\n"
    910     "  console. see the help for the 'window scale' command for details\n\n" );
    911 }

   1038 static void
   1039 help_logcat(stralloc_t*  out)
   1040 {
   1041     PRINTF(
   1042     "  use '-logcat <tags>' to redirect log messages from the emulated system to\n"
   1043     "  the current terminal. <tags> is a list of space/comma-separated log filters\n"
   1044     "  where each filter has the following format:\n\n"
   1045 
   1046     "     <componentName>:<logLevel>\n\n"
   1047 
   1048     "  where <componentName> is either '*' or the name of a given component,\n"
   1049     "  and <logLevel> is one of the following letters:\n\n"
   1050 
   1051     "      v          verbose level\n"
   1052     "      d          debug level\n"
   1053     "      i          informative log level\n"
   1054     "      w          warning log level\n"
   1055     "      e          error log level\n"
   1056     "      s          silent log level\n\n"
   1057 
   1058     "  for example, the following only displays messages from the 'GSM' component\n"
   1059     "  that are at least at the informative level:\n\n"
   1060 
   1061     "    -logcat '*:s GSM:i'\n\n"
   1062 
   1063     "  if '-logcat <tags>' is not used, the emulator looks for ANDROID_LOG_TAGS\n"
   1064     "  in the environment. if it is defined, its value must match the <tags>\n"
   1065     "  format and will be used to redirect log messages to the terminal.\n\n"
   1066 
   1067     "  note that this doesn't prevent you from redirecting the same, or other,\n"
   1068     "  log messages through the ADB or DDMS tools too.\n\n");
   1069 }
   1070 
   1071 static void
   1072 help_no_audio(stralloc_t*  out)
   1073 {
   1074     PRINTF(
   1075     "  use '-no-audio' to disable all audio support in the emulator. this may be\n"
   1076     "  unfortunately be necessary in some cases:\n\n"
   1077 
   1078     "  * at least two users have reported that their Windows machine rebooted\n"
   1079     "    instantly unless they used this option when starting the emulator.\n"
   1080     "    it is very likely that the problem comes from buggy audio drivers.\n\n"
   1081 
   1082     "  * on some Linux machines, the emulator might get stuck at startup with\n"
   1083     "    audio support enabled. this problem is hard to reproduce, but seems to\n"
   1084     "    be related too to flaky ALSA / audio driver support.\n\n"
   1085 
   1086     "  on Linux, another option is to try to change the default audio backend\n"
   1087     "  used by the emulator. you can do that by setting the QEMU_AUDIO_DRV\n"
   1088     "  environment variables to one of the following values:\n\n"
   1089 
   1090     "    alsa        (use the ALSA backend)\n"
   1091     "    esd         (use the EsounD backend)\n"
   1092     "    sdl         (use the SDL audio backend, no audio input supported)\n"
   1093     "    oss         (use the OSS backend)\n"
   1094     "    none        (do not support audio)\n"
   1095     "\n"
   1096     "  the very brave can also try to use distinct backends for audio input\n"
   1097     "  and audio outputs, this is possible by selecting one of the above values\n"
   1098     "  into the QEMU_AUDIO_OUT_DRV and QEMU_AUDIO_IN_DRV environment variables.\n\n"
   1099     );
   1100 }

   1141 static void
   1142 help_port(stralloc_t*  out)
   1143 {
   1144     PRINTF(
   1145     "  at startup, the emulator tries to bind its control console at a free port\n"
   1146     "  starting from 5554, in increments of two (i.e. 5554, then 5556, 5558, etc..)\n"
   1147     "  this allows several emulator instances to run concurrently on the same\n"
   1148     "  machine, each one using a different console port number.\n\n"
   1149 
   1150     "  use '-port <port>' to force an emulator instance to use a given console port\n\n"
   1151 
   1152     "  note that <port> must be an *even* integer between 5554 and 5584 included.\n"
   1153     "  <port>+1 must also be free and will be reserved for ADB. if any of these\n"
   1154     "  ports is already used, the emulator will fail to start.\n\n" );
   1155 }
   1156 
   1157 static void
   1158 help_ports(stralloc_t*  out)
   1159 {
   1160     PRINTF(
   1161     "  the '-ports <consoleport>,<adbport>' option allows you to explicitely set\n"
   1162     "  the TCP ports used by the emulator to implement its control console and\n"
   1163     "  communicate with the ADB tool.\n\n"
   1164 
   1165     "  This is a very special option that should probably *not* be used by typical\n"
   1166     "  developers using the Android SDK (use '-port <port>' instead), because the\n"
   1167     "  corresponding instance is probably not going to be seen from adb/DDMS. Its\n"
   1168     "  purpose is to use the emulator in very specific network configurations.\n\n"
   1169 
   1170     "    <consoleport> is the TCP port used to bind the control console\n"
   1171     "    <adbport> is the TCP port used to bind the ADB local transport/tunnel.\n\n"
   1172 
   1173     "  If both ports aren't available on startup, the emulator will exit.\n\n");
   1174 }

   1424 static void
   1425 help_shared_net_id(stralloc_t*  out)
   1426 {
   1427     PRINTF(
   1428     "  Normally, Android instances running in the emulator cannot talk to each other\n"
   1429     "  directly, because each instance is behind a virtual router. However, sometimes\n"
   1430     "  it is necessary to test the behaviour of applications if they are directly\n"
   1431     "  exposed to the network.\n\n"
   1432 
   1433     "  This option instructs the emulator to join a virtual network shared with\n"
   1434     "  emulators also using this option. The number given is used to construct\n"
   1435     "  the IP address 10.1.2.<number>, which is bound to a second interface on\n"
   1436     "  the emulator. Each emulator must use a different number.\n\n"
   1437     );
   1438 }
   1439 
   1440 static void
   1441 help_gpu(stralloc_t* out)
   1442 {
   1443     PRINTF(
   1444     "  Use -gpu <mode> to override the mode of hardware OpenGL ES emulation\n"
   1445     "  indicated by the AVD. Valid values for <mode> are:\n\n"
   1446 
   1447     "     on       -> enable GPU emulation\n"
   1448     "     off      -> disable GPU emulation\n"
   1449     "     auto     -> use the setting from the AVD\n"
   1450     "     enabled  -> same as 'on'\n"
   1451     "     disabled -> same as 'off'\n\n"
   1452 
   1453     "  Note that enabling GPU emulation if the system image does not support it\n"
   1454     "  will prevent the proper display of the emulated framebuffer.\n\n"
   1455 
   1456     "  You can always disable GPU emulation (i.e. '-gpu off'), and this will\n"
   1457     "  force the virtual device to use the slow software renderer instead.\n"
   1458     "  Note that OpenGLES 2.0 is _not_ supported by it.\n\n"
   1459 
   1460     "  The 'auto' mode is the default. In this mode, the hw.gpu.enabled setting\n"
   1461     "  in the AVD's hardware-qemu.ini file will determine whether GPU emulation\n"
   1462     "  is enabled.\n\n"
   1463 
   1464     "  Even if hardware GPU emulation is enabled, if the host-side OpenGL ES\n"
   1465     "  emulation library cannot be initialized, the emulator will run with GPU\n"
   1466     "  emulation disabled rather than failing to start.\n"
   1467     );
   1468 }
